Helen Wills Moody (1905-1998) SELF PORTRAIT ON THE TENNIS COURT Signed, original pencil & watercolour drawing, 37.5 by 34.5cm., 15 by 13 1/2in. The image has been completed on what appears to be a piece of watercolour board which has a further landscape drawing by her on the reverse. Interestingly, there is also a hand written note which reads, “Reserved for Mr. Macauley”. This may well be Lt. Col. A.D.C. 'Duncan' Macaulay (O.B.E.) an author and journalist who was once Secretary/Chief Executive to the All England Club, Wimbledon. Accompanied by a press photograph showing Helen Wills Moody at the Bernheim Art Galleries in Paris, at an exhibition of her work in 1932.

* ALASDAIR GRAY, PORTRAIT OF A FRIEND mixed media on paper 39cm x 36cm Mounted, framed and under glass Alasdair Gray (born 28 December 1934) is a Scottish writer and artist. His most acclaimed work is his first novel, ``Lanark``, published in 1981 and written over a period of almost 30 years. It is now regarded as a classic, and was described by The Guardian as ``one of the landmarks of 20th century fiction.`` His novel ``Poor things``(1992) won the Whitbread Novel Award and the Guardian Fiction Prize. Gray illustrates his own books and has painted murals in notable Glasgow West End locations including the Ubiquitous chip, Oran Mor and Hillhead Underground Station. The artist has many works in public and private collections and a major exhibition of the artist`s work will be held soon at Kelvingrove Museum and Art Gallery.

* PATRICK REDMOND (IRISH CONTEMPORARY), BOILED SWEETS oil on canvas, signed verso 23cm x 35cm Framed Note: Patrick Redmond was born in Wexford in 1976. He has had four solo exhibitions at the Molesworth Gallery and one at The Wexford Arts Centre. He has shown at the RHA Annual Exhibition in Dublin and the BP Portrait Award Exhibition at the National Gallery, London. He has also participated in curated group shows at the Iontas Arts Centre in Co. Monaghan and the Garter Lane Arts Centre in Co. Waterford.
1881 A signed photograph of Charles Stewart Parnell A sepia head and shoulders photographic portrait of Charles Stewart Parnell, by Henry O`Shea, Photographer, Limerick. The mount inscribed: My dear Mr O`Shea - I think this very good - Yours truly - Chas S Parnell - Kilmainham Dec 19 1881"".
1916 Who dares to speak of Easter week? Poster. A contemporary poster titled Who dares to speak of Easter Week?"" flanked by a Croppy Boy and an Irish Volunteer, centred by a patriotic ballad and surrounded by portrait vignettes of the leaders of the rising above ""The Irish Rebellion of 1916 and its martyrs - Erin`s tragic Easter"". Published by the Devlin-Adair company New York, 1916."" 25 x 19in. (63½ x 48.26cm)
1920s Kevin Barry, patriotic allagorical portrait. Died for Ireland Nov. 1st 1920. Barry in a football jersey, flanked by Tricolours, with rifle bayonets and a Volunteer cap, over a harp and wolfhound, with the bannered words Dia trócaire ar a n-anam"" (""May God have mercy on their souls""). Oil on paper laid on canvas, 20 ins x 16 ins, the central portrait painted over a printed image. Unsigned, undated, c1920. Framed."" 20 x 16in. (50.80 x 40.64cm)
